In addition to Blazer (who recently played the Beggar Woman in the New York City Opera production of Sweeney Todd), The Artist's Crossing's first company includes actors David Garrison and Malcolm Gets, director Tina Landau, opera singer Lee Merrill, and music director and composer Joseph Thalken. Completing the staff are Joseph Bates, Jen Bender, and Landon Scott Heimbach. They will work with a select group of students in group classes, private lessons and coaching, personal consultations, conversations at meals, and rehearsals for a public presentation on July 24 in which both the teachers and students will perform.
All participants must be between the ages of 18-27 and must have completed at least one year of college as an acting, musical theater, music, or dance major as of June 2004. The total cost of the program is $2,200, which includes housing at Wright State University, three meals a day with the 2004 company members, participation in all classes, the final performance presentation, and transportation to and from the airport.
